Given a collection of distinct integers, return all possible permutations.

Example:

Input: [1,2,3]
Output:
[
  [1,2,3],
  [1,3,2],
  [2,1,3],
  [2,3,1],
  [3,1,2],
  [3,2,1]
]

难度:medium

题目:给定一组集合元素,返回其所有排列数。

思路:递归

class Solution {
    public List<List<Integer>> permute(int[] nums) {
        List<List<Integer>> result = new ArrayList<>();
        permute(nums, 0, new Stack<Integer>(), result);
        
        return result;
    }
    
    private void permute(int[] nums, int idx, Stack<Integer> stack, List<List<Integer>> result) {
        if (idx == nums.length) {
            result.add(new ArrayList<>(stack));
            return;
        }
        
        for (int i = idx; i < nums.length; i++) {
            stack.push(nums[i]);
            swap(nums, i, idx);
            permute(nums, idx + 1, stack, result);
            swap(nums, i, idx);
            stack.pop();
        }
    }

    private void swap(int[] nums, int i, int j) {
        int t = nums[i];
        nums[i] = nums[j];
        nums[j] = t;
    }
}
